What are free vs paid journals

Open access journals are freely available to any individual that has internet access. They provide free content on the internet and charge researchers or scholars for publishing their findings. On the other hand, paid journals charge readers a hefty fee to explore the content of the journal.

Why do journals charge to publish

Most commonly, it is involved in making a work available as open access (OA), in either a full OA journal or in a hybrid journal. This fee may be paid by the author, the author's institution, or their research funder. Sometimes, publication fees are also involved in traditional journals or for paywalled content.

Why is publication fee so expensive

Some journals are able to provide a much lower fee for publication because the government, a university, or a society subsidizes them. Journals with a higher publication fee defend their costs by saying they put more effort into reviewing and editing each article, and are more selective about the articles published.

Should I pay to publish a paper

The need for payment arises only if the manuscript is accepted for publication. If the manuscript is rejected, the author usually does not have to pay anything. Beware of journals that request APCs at the time of submission. They might not be trustworthy.

Why does it cost so much to publish an article

There is also a significant amount of work done behind the scenes that takes a paper from submission to publication. Publishers often have to edit, proofread, check for plagiarism, and send the papers for peer review, all which increase the cost of publishing.

Why is it so expensive to publish an article

The simple reason is that the main costs aren't per-unit costs, but maintaining the technology operation to support processing articles. To produce an article, an author has to submit a manuscript—so the journal must maintain software to take in those manuscripts and allow editors to manage the review process.
